ASTM is the new industry standard of testing. It replaces ANSI
Z41 PT91 standard for testing.
"This specification covers the
minimum requirements for the design, performance, and classification
of footwear designed to provide protection against work place hazards.
This new ASTM standard will replace the current
ANSI Z-41 Standard for Personal Protective Footwear which has been
the foundation for worker safety as it relates to performance safety
footwear as required under OSHA guidelines." (Date
Initiated: 03-19-2004)
